Abstract: | Summary We show a strong type of conditionally mixing property for the Gibbs states ofd-dimensional Ising model when the temperature is above the critical one. By using this property, we show that there is always coexistence of infinite (+ *)-and (–*)-clusters when is smaller than c andh=0 in two dimensions.
